What companies run services between Savannah, GA, USA and Madison, WI, USA?

Delta, United Airlines, and American Airlines fly from Savannah (SAV) to Dane County Regional Airport-Truax Field (MSN) hourly.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Savannah Bus Station to 250 N. Lake St - Madison UW Campus via Atlanta Bus Station, Chicago Bus Station, and W Jackson Blvd, after S Clinton St in around 25h 56m.
